Menugo’s Restaurant Menu Maker Goes Beta, Opens To New Users

Menugo has pulled the wraps off it’s new menu editor which serves restaurants wanting to manage their printed menus online.

The cloud based service is offering free menu templates that restaurants can use to design, manage, and print their in-house restaurant menus. There are great templated designs, and It includes promotional materials that a restaurant might want, such as placemats, table-top displays, and takeout menus.

Nico McMasters, CEO and founder explained, “The entire dining experience starts before you set foot in the restaurant. It starts with discovery, exploring places to try, and making an emotional connection when you see that menu. You can almost feel yourself there. The Menugo platform is designed to bring that emotional connection and staying power to your customers.”

Other features coming to the platform include online ordering from your menu, social media marketing, and professional printing with special coatings and laminations. There is also a way to get located on Google Maps, as well as to publish to Facebook, and manage other social media accounts.
